Multicultural Organisations In and Around Yarra Glen, Victoria, Australia
Introduction:
The town of Yarra Glen is situated in the heart of the Yarra Valley wine region, approximately 50 kilometres northeast of Melbourne. It is a place where different cultures coexist and thrive harmoniously. The community is a multicultural one, and there are many organisations located both within the town and nearby that cater to the needs and interests of people from diverse ethnic backgrounds.
In this article, we will discuss some of the multicultural organisations in and around Yarra Glen and the benefits and activities offered by them.
1. The Multicultural Council of Victoria:
The Multicultural Council of Victoria (MCV) is a non-profit organisation that works towards building a diverse, inclusive, and harmonious Victoria. The MCV provides information, advocacy, and representation to Victoria's multicultural communities at all levels of government and society.
Benefits: The MCV aims to promote cultural diversity and harmony and to reduce racism and discrimination. It offers a range of services, including community development, youth leadership programme, volunteering, and advocacy. The MCV provides training, events, and resources to help raise awareness about multiculturalism and to assist organisations in becoming more inclusive.
Activities: The MCV holds regular events and workshops that celebrate Victoria's multicultural diversity and promote intercultural understanding. These include the Victoria Multicultural Festival, International Women's Day, Harmony Day, Cultural Competence Training and forums, and many other activities.
